Conversion of Measuring Mass

In the conversion of measuring mass, we will explain how to convert kilograms into grams, grams into kilograms, kilograms & grams into grams, and grams into kilograms & grams.

How to Convert Kilograms to Grams?

Multiply the number of kilograms by 1000 for converting kilograms into grams.

Example 1:

Convert 28 kg into grams

Solution:

28 kg

Multiply the number of kgs with 1000 to convert kg to grams.

= 28 × 1000 g

= 28000 g

Therefore 28 kg is converted to 28000g

Example 2:

Convert 64 kg into grams

Solution:

64 kg

Multiply the number of kgs with 1000 to convert kg to grams.

= 64 × 1000 g

= 64000 g

Therefore, 64 kg is converted to 64000 g.

How to Convert Grams to Kilograms?

Divide the number of grams by 1000 for converting grams into kilograms. or put a dot (.) after 3 digits from the right of the number.

Example 1:

Convert 28000 g into kg

Solution:

Divide the number of grams by 1000 for converting grams into kilograms.  or put a dot (.) after 3 digits from the right of the number.

28000÷1000=28 kg

Therefore 28000g is converted to 28 kg.

Converting Kilograms and Grams into Grams

We have to multiply the number of kilograms by 1000 and add it to the number of grams for converting kilograms and grams into grams.

Example 1:

Convert 5 kg 450 g into g

Solution:

We have to multiply the number of kilograms by 1000 and add it to the number of grams for converting kilograms and grams into grams.

= 5 × 1000 g + 450 g

= 5000 g + 450 g

= 5450 g

Therefore, 5 kg 450 g is converted to 5450 g

Conversion of Grams into Kilograms and Grams

Divide the number of grams by 1000 for converting grams into kilograms and grams the quotient represents kilograms and the remainder represents gram.

Example 1:

Convert 7320 g to kilograms and grams

Solution:

Divide the number of grams by 1000 for converting grams into kilograms and grams the quotient represents kilograms and the remainder represents gram.

=7320 ÷ 1000

=7 kg 320 g

Therefore, 7320 g is converted to 7 kg 320 g.

Tip: Put a point after three digits from the right of the number, it represents grams and the remaining represent kgs.

2.920

=2 kg 920 gm
